Classe IV B A.s. 2012 – 2013 Programma di Sistemi 5 ore (3 laboratorio) Docenti –Prof. Alberto Ferrari –Prof. Italo DallAre.

Slides:



Advertisements
Presentazioni simili
Prof. Rebecca Montanari Anno accademico 2011/2012
Advertisements

Informazioni sul corso a.a
Reti Logiche e Architettura dei Calcolatori
1 Introduzione ai calcolatori Parte II Software di base.
Classe III A A.s – 2010 Programma di Informatica
Classe III A A.s – 2011 Sistemi di Elaborazione e Trasmissione dell’Informazione 4 ore settimanali (2 laboratorio) Docenti Prof. Alberto Ferrari.
Classe IV B A.s – 2009 Programma di Informatica 6 ore (3 laboratorio) Docenti –Prof. Alberto Ferrari –Prof. Alberto Paganuzzi.
3A Informatica A.s
Classe V B A.s – 2008 Programma di Informatica Docenti
Classe V A A.s – 2013 Programma di Informatica 5 ore (3 laboratorio) Docenti –Prof. Alberto Ferrari –Prof. Alberto Paganuzzi.
Classe III A A.s – 2011 Programma di Informatica 5 ore settimanali (3 laboratorio) Docenti –Prof. Alberto Ferrari –Prof. Alberto Paganuzzi.
Procedure e funzioni A. Ferrari.
Tutte le componenti non facenti parte dellunità centrale, unità di I/O, memorie di massa, dispositivi come stampanti, scanner ed in generale tutte le apparecchiature.
Sistemi Operativi Menù: 1) Introduzione al sistema operativo
IL COMPUTER Il computer, o elaboratore, è un insieme di dispositivi (meccanici, elettrici,ottici) predisposti per accettare dati dallesterno, elaborarli.
Fondamenti di Informatica Prof. Cantone
Relatore:. Prof. Fabrizio FERRANDI Correlatore:. Ing. Marco D
Presentazione del corso di SISTEMI OPERATIVI
INTRODUZIONE AI SISTEMI OPERATIVI
Elaborazione di Immagini e Suoni Syllabus
Introduzione al calcolo parallelo SISTEMI INFORMATIVI AZIENDALI Pierpaolo Guerra Anno accademico 2009/2010.
Il Software: Obiettivi Programmare direttamente la macchina hardware è molto difficile: lutente dovrebbe conoscere lorganizzazione fisica del computer.
Reti Logiche e Architettura dei Calcolatori Luciano Gualà home page
Università degli Studi di Bergamo Facoltà di Lingue e Letterature Straniere Facoltà di Lettere e Filosofia A.A Informatica generale 1 Appunti.
Struttura dei sistemi operativi (panoramica)
Sistemi Operativi Distribuiti: indice
INTRODUZIONE MOTIVAZIONI, PEREQUISITI, ARGOMENTI.
Capitolo 1: Introduzione ai computer e a Java
Il sistema operativo Vito Perrone
SOFTWARE I componenti fisici del calcolatore (unità centrale e periferiche) costituiscono il cosiddetto Hardware (alla lettera, ferramenta). La struttura.
Gestione della memoria logica e fisica degli elaboratori x86
Architettura degli elaboratori
SISTEMI A MICROPROCESSORE prof. Maurizio Rebaudengo
Architettura di un calcolatore
Corso di abilità informatiche
Fondamenti di informatica Linguaggio C Main Program: Architettura di un PC Diagrammi di flusso Linguaggio C.
Elementi di Informatica Simone Scalabrin a.a. 2008/2009.
INTRODUZIONE l sistema operativo è il primo software che lutente utilizza quando accende il computer; 1)Viene caricato nella memoria RAM con loperazione.
ELETTRONICA DIGITALE (II Parte)
I blocchi fondamentali dell’elaborazione Componenti e funzionamento del calcolatore I blocchi fondamentali dell’elaborazione.
Il sistema operativo.
IL DOCENTE E I NUOVI STRUMENTI PER LA DIDATTICA
Esame di didattica dell’informatica II
Percorso in piattaforma GIUGNO 2013 Prof. ssa Maria Antonia Vesce /Ass
Seconda Università degli Studi di Napoli Facoltà di Economia Corso di Informatica Prof.ssa Zahora Pina.
Il Sistema Operativo (1)
Programma di Informatica Classi Prime
Sistemi ad elevate prestazioni Lezione 1
CURRICOLO DI SISTEMI DI ELABORAZIONE E TRASMISSIONE DELLE INFORMAZIONI PER ISTITUTI TECNICI INDUSTRIALI CLASSE III Progetto ABACUS Progetto ABACUS GRUPPO.
ELETTRONICA DIGITALE (II PARTE) (1)
Capitolo 0 : Introduzione al corso CdL in Ingegneria Elettronica e delle Telecomunicazioni: Fondamenti dei S.O. (6CFU) Capitolo 0 : Introduzione al corso.
Corso di WebMaster Mercoledì 14 Novembre. Parte I – Introduzione al Corso Lezione 1: Presentazione Descrizione Breve del Corso Semplice Valutazione.
I processi.
1 Laboratorio di Introduzione alla Programmazione-Informazioni §II MODULO §3 crediti §Esame e voto unico (su 6 crediti totali)
Classe IV A A.s – 2013 Programma di Informatica 5 ore (3 laboratorio) Docenti –Prof. Alberto Ferrari –Prof. Alberto Paganuzzi.
INTERFACCE Schede elettroniche che permettono al calcolatore di comunicare con le periferiche, che possono essere progettate e costruite in modo molto.
Calcolatori Elettronici Il Processore
1 Sommario degli argomenti  Sistemi operativi: DOS, Unix/Linux,Windows  Word processors: Word  Fogli elettronici: Excel  Reti: TCP/IP, Internet, ftp,
Il software Componente del computer costituita dai: –programmi di base per la gestione del sistema –programmi applicativi per l’uso del sistema Queste.
1 Laboratorio di Introduzione alla Programmazione-Informazioni §II MODULO §3 crediti §Esame e voto unico (su 6 crediti totali)
Parte IIElementi di Informatica1 Introduzione ai sistemi operativi Parte II.
Informatica Lezione 6 Psicologia dello sviluppo e dell'educazione (laurea magistrale) Anno accademico:
I primi elaboratori Anni ‘50 Rigidamente sequenziali
Il teorema di PITAGORA (produzione di un ipertesto) GRUPPO 8
Tipo Documento: unità didattica 1 Modulo 14 Compilatore: Antonella Bolzoni Supervisore: Data emissione: Release: Indice: A.Scheda informativa B.Introduzione.
Parte IIConoscenze Informatiche1 Introduzione ai sistemi operativi e WindowsX Parte II.
INTRODUZIONE AI SISTEMI OPERATIVI. Introduzione Il software può essere diviso un due grandi classi: Il software può essere diviso un due grandi classi:
© 2016 Giorgio Porcu - Aggiornamennto 18/03/2016 I STITUTO T ECNICO SECONDO BIENNIO T ECNOLOGIE E P ROGETTAZIONE Il Sistema Operativo Concorrenza e Grafi.
HARDWARE (2). MEMORIE Due classi di memoria MEMORIA CENTRALE –media capacità - ottima velocità MEMORIA DI MASSA elevata capacità - bassa velocità.
Classe V A A.s – 2012 Programma di Informatica
Transcript della presentazione:

Classe IV B A.s – 2013 Programma di Sistemi 5 ore (3 laboratorio) Docenti –Prof. Alberto Ferrari –Prof. Italo DallAre

Obiettivi Conoscere i concetti di base su evoluzione e struttura dei sistemi operativi. Saper applicare principi e modelli della programmazione concorrente. Conoscere i livelli più bassi di un sistema operativo: sincronizzazione di processi elementari, gestione delle interruzioni hardware e software. Utilizzare le risorse di base (software e firmware) di un sistema operativo per lo sviluppo di semplici applicazioni. Utilizzare un linguaggio di programmazione che consenta un buon livello di astrazione nella definizione dei processi e la visibilità dell'hardware.

Contenuti (1) Concorrenza nei sistemi di elaborazione: modello "pipelined", prefetching, memorie cache, coprocessori. Introduzione ad un linguaggio di sistema adatto a capire e sviluppare piccoli moduli di software di base a diversi livelli di astrazione. Cenni ai linguaggi per la programmazione concorrente.

Contenuti (2) Sistemi Operativi Risorse, processi, processori, parallelismo reale e virtuale, cooperazione/competizione, sincronizzazione. Gestione delle eccezioni hardware e software. Nucleo, schedulazione a basso livello e stati di un processo. Sincronizzazione mediante semafori. Rappresentazione e gestione fisica di file e indirizzari sul disco. Tecniche elementari di gestione della memoria.